Everlaw.com is a cloud-based e-discovery and litigation platform in the legal technology industry that provides document review, case preparation, evidence management, and analytics for law firms, corporate legal teams, and government agencies. What is everlaw.com's primary business model?
Everlaw operates a software-as-a-service (SaaS) business model, selling cloud-native eDiscovery, litigation and investigation tools to law firms, corporate legal departments, and government agencies on a subscription basis. Its revenue comes from platform subscriptions, add-on services such as analytics and managed review, and professional services for implementation and support.
Is everlaw.com considered a market leader, a challenger, or a niche player?
Everlaw is generally considered a challenger in the eDiscovery and litigation technology market. While not the largest incumbent, it has grown rapidly by offering a modern, cloud-native alternative to legacy platforms and competing strongly with other innovative providers.
What makes everlaw.com unique compared to its competitors?
Everlaw is distinguished by its cloud-native architecture, an intuitive and collaborative user interface, and integrated tools that span early case assessment, document review, analytics, and courtroom presentation (including features like Storybuilder and timeline visualization). It also emphasizes machine learning-assisted review, strong security and audit capabilities, and workflows designed to support teams working together across matters.
